Output e584414094f37362bfad2ff4ac5e33e54173feadabcf2ea7feaf37d07ebafa83:0

value
8539
script pubkey
OP_0 OP_PUSHBYTES_20 1a5e2ab7c00260eb173a864af83a6d28539fe031
address
bc1qrf0z4d7qqfswk9e6se90swnd9pfelcp37wlpp3
transaction
e584414094f37362bfad2ff4ac5e33e54173feadabcf2ea7feaf37d07ebafa83
confirmations
1089
spent
false